A professional employer organization sic Code employer organisation (PEO) is an outsourcing firm that supplies solutions to medium-sized and little businesses (SMBs). There are lots of PEOs readily available and every one offers its own schedule of solutions.

This is due to the fact that PEOs normally have their own relationships with a particular collection of firms that supply health insurance, retirement plans and other benefits. They frequently offer medical care strategies, life insurance and handicap insurance, retirement plans, worksite benefits, dependent care, commuter advantages and even more.

Since they co-employ a significant number of workers, PEOs have access to extensive benefits for small companies at cost effective rates. In addition to time savings, a PEO may save you money by improving your hiring practices and securing the best prices with insurance companies and various other advantages carriers.

Usually, the PEO offering might include personnel risk, consulting and security mitigation services, pay-roll processing, company pay-roll tax declaring, employees' settlement insurance policy, health benefits, employers' technique and responsibility insurance policy (EPLI), retirement cars (401(k) ), regulatory compliance help, workforce administration modern technology, and training and development.
